Meaning: The provided surface input into the surface frame connection is not a valid surface. This is an internal software failure where a planar object was provided but does not properly behave as a surface.
Recovery:
-
Open the Structure task.
-
Click Select .
-
Set the Locate Filter to Frame Connections.
-
Select the frame connection in error.
-
Select More from the Connection box on the ribbon.
-
Click Surface in the tree view and then select Surface-Default in the list view.
-
Redefine the end location of the member.
